1. Tomlin on Ben Retirement Talk

“He said it so you take it seriously. That’s a fair assessment of where he is in his career. I’m not alarmed by it. That’s football. Potential of his return or not will weigh heavily on our planning. Not surprised by that thought [hide] process. That’s life. We’ll plan and react accordingly. We haven’t met yet. General our plan, he is one of the last, if not the last player [to hold exit meetings].”

On complexity of replacing Ben if he retires

“Potential for it is extremely significant because of the position.”

Tomlin said it’s not the first time he’s heard Ben question his future and Ben has told him in the past retirement was on his mind.
